Android是一种基于Linux的自由及开放源代码的操作系统,目前该系统也是使用人数最多的的手机操作系统,
Android应用开发一开始并不是由谷歌开发,最早是由Andy Rubin开发,谷歌是在2005年全工作就像轮-奸,,你不行了别人就上。资收购android的,谷歌收购android后,用六年时间超过但是市场份额占有率最大的塞班,跃居全球第一。
做过ja va开发的同学对Eclipse很熟悉,其实Android应用开发可以在Eclipse环命运就像强-奸,你反抗不了就要学会享受。境开发运行,有的同学会问,Eclipse是做java开发的,怎么可以做android开发呢,因为android的应用软件基本上都是用java开发,所以在做Android应用开发时,同样也可以用Ec如果有钱也是一种错,那我情愿一错再错。lipse环境下开发。
Android平台被称为一个产品组合,因为它是一系列组件的集合,包括: 基于Linux内核的操作系统,Java编程环境,工具集,包括编译器、资源编译器、调试器和模拟器用来运行只要功夫深,拉屎也认真啊!应用程序的Dalvik VMAndroid有丰富的功能,因此很容易与桌面操作系统混淆。Android是一个分层的环境,构建在Linux内核的基础上,它包括丰富的功能。UI 子系统包括:窗口,视图 用于开会就像乱-伦,搞不清谁该搞谁。显示一些常见组件的小部件,Android包括一个构建在WebKit基础上的可嵌入浏览器,iPhone 的Mobile Safari浏览器同样也是以WebKit为基础。
Android运行在Lin工资就像例假,一月不来你就傻眼。ux内核上。Android应用程序是用Java编程语言编写的,它们在一个虚拟机(VM)中运行。需要注意的是,这个VM并非您想象中的JVM,而是Dalvik Virtual Machine,这是一种开源工作就像轮-奸,,你不行了别人就上。技术。每个Android应用程序都在Dalvik VM的一个实例中运行,这个实例驻留在一个由Linux内核管理的进程中,如下图所示。